Introduction:
In the rapidly evolving landscape of web development, staying ahead of the competition is crucial to achieving success. In this digital age, where user expectations are sky-high, developers need a powerful toolset to create exceptional web applications. Enter Angular, the web developer's secret weapon for unstoppable success. With its impressive features, robust architecture, and extensive community support, Angular empowers developers to build stunning and performant web applications. In this article, we will explore why Angular is the secret weapon that can take your web development career to new heights.
Supercharged Productivity:
Angular offers a powerful set of tools and features that boost developer productivity. From its declarative templates and extensive library of pre-built components to its command-line interface (CLI) and code generation capabilities, Angular streamlines the development process and eliminates repetitive tasks. Developers can quickly scaffold projects, generate code, and automate common workflows, allowing them to focus more on building innovative features and less on boilerplate code.
Scalable and Modular Architecture:
Angular follows a modular architecture that promotes code organization and scalability. With its component-based structure, developers can break down their application into reusable and independent modules, making it easier to maintain, test, and extend the codebase. The use of dependency injection further enhances the modularity, enabling efficient management of dependencies and facilitating code reuse.
Enhanced Performance:
Angular's performance optimization techniques, such as change detection, lazy loading, and Ahead-of-Time (AOT) compilation, ensure that web applications built with Angular are lightning-fast and deliver exceptional user experiences. Angular's change detection mechanism intelligently updates only the necessary parts of the application when data changes, resulting in optimal performance and reduced overhead.
Robust Testing Capabilities:
Angular provides robust testing capabilities, making it easier to ensure the quality and stability of web applications. The framework supports different types of testing, including unit testing, integration testing, and end-to-end testing. With tools like Jasmine and Protractor, developers can write comprehensive test suites to validate their application's behavior and catch potential bugs early in the development process.
Seamless Data Binding:
Angular's two-way data binding simplifies the synchronization between the model and the view, enabling real-time updates and reducing manual effort. Changes made to the data are automatically reflected in the user interface, providing a seamless and responsive experience. This powerful feature eliminates the need for explicit DOM manipulation and enables developers to build dynamic and interactive applications with ease.
Rich Ecosystem and Community Support:
Angular boasts a vast ecosystem with a wide range of libraries, tools, and extensions that enhance the development process. From Angular Material for beautiful and responsive UI components to NgRx for state management, developers have access to a wealth of resources to accelerate their projects. In addition, Angular has a robust developer community that actively supports its expansion.Online forums, tutorials, and meetups provide avenues for learning, collaboration, and sharing best practices.
Cross-Platform Development:
With Angular, developers can leverage their skills to build applications for various platforms. Angular supports cross-platform development, allowing developers to create web applications, desktop applications, and even mobile applications using frameworks like Ionic. This versatility eliminates the need for separate codebases and enables code reuse, saving time and effort.
Backed by Google:
Angular is backed by Google, one of the world's leading technology companies. This backing ensures a strong commitment to ongoing development, support, and updates. Google's resources and expertise contribute to the continuous improvement of Angular, making it a reliable and future-proof choice for web development.
Conclusion:
Angular is undoubtedly the web developer's secret weapon for achieving unstoppable success. Its productivity-enhancing features, modular architecture, performance optimization techniques, robust testing capabilities, seamless data binding, rich ecosystem, cross-platform support, and the support of Google make it a force to be reckoned with in the web development world. By mastering Angular, developers can unlock their full potential, build exceptional web applications, and propel their careers to new heights. Embrace Angular today and gain the competitive edge needed to succeed in the dynamic and fast-paced field of web development.
In today's digital age, web applications have become an integral part of businesses across industries. To stay competitive in the ever-evolving web development landscape, it is essential to master the right tools and frameworks. One such framework is AngularJS, a powerful JavaScript-based framework that allows developers to build dynamic and responsive web applications. In this article, we will explore the benefits of AngularJS training in Chennai and how it can help aspiring developers unlock their potential in the world of web development.
The Power of AngularJS:AngularJS is known for its ability to simplify complex web development tasks. It provides developers with a structured framework that allows for the efficient creation of interactive user interfaces. With AngularJS, you can easily manage data binding, handle form validation, and implement real-time updates, all while maintaining clean and organized code. By gaining expertise in AngularJS, you will be equipped with the necessary skills to build powerful and engaging web applications.
Comprehensive Training Program:Chennai is a hub for technology and offers a wide range of training programs for aspiring developers. AngularJS training in Chennai provides a comprehensive curriculum designed to cover all aspects of the framework. From the basics of AngularJS to advanced concepts such as routing, services, and directives, the training program ensures that participants gain a deep understanding of the framework's capabilities. The program typically includes hands-on exercises, projects, and real-world examples to enhance practical learning.
Experienced and Industry-Recognized Trainers:To ensure the effectiveness of the training program, AngularJS training institutes in Chennai have a team of experienced and industry-recognized trainers. These trainers bring their expertise and real-world experience to the classroom, providing participants with valuable insights and practical knowledge. Learning from seasoned professionals not only helps in understanding the nuances of AngularJS but also provides valuable guidance on best practices and industry trends.
Practical Application and Project Work:AngularJS training in Chennai emphasizes practical application and project work. Participants are provided with ample opportunities to apply their knowledge and skills to real-world scenarios. Through hands-on exercises and project-based learning, participants gain confidence in building web applications using AngularJS. This practical approach ensures that participants are well-prepared to tackle real-world challenges and contribute to web development projects effectively.
Placement Assistance and Career Support:One of the key advantages ofAngularJS training in Chennaiis the placement assistance and career support provided by training institutes. These institutes often have tie-ups with leading companies in the industry, and they leverage their connections to help participants secure job placements. From resume building to interview preparation, participants receive guidance and support to kick-start their careers in web development.
Conclusion:
AngularJS training in Chennai offers a comprehensive learning experience that equips aspiring developers with the skills needed to build dynamic and interactive web applications. With a structured curriculum, experienced trainers, practical application, and placement assistance, participants can gain the confidence and knowledge to excel in the web development industry. By mastering AngularJS, you can unlock a world of opportunities and embark on a rewarding career in web development. So, take the leap and enroll inAngularJS training in Chennaito unleash your potential and become a sought-after web developer.